  • Product Introduction

      Kyanite is one of the minerals in the kyanite family, usually with flat columnar crystals and island like structures. 
      Color: cyan, blue, glass luster, relative hardness: anisotropy//c-axis 5.5, Å c-axis 6.5~7, volume density 3.53~3.65g/cm3.

    Kyanite 80 mesh is a high-quality fine powder with excellent thermal stability and expansion properties. It transforms into mullite at high temperatures, improving density and strength in refractory applications. Widely used in castables, ceramics, and kiln linings, it enhances resistance to thermal shock and corrosion. As a key component in Kyanite refractory material, it supports durability and performance in high-temperature environments.

    Product Characteristics

      ● Natural crystalline raw materials with high fire resistance;

      ● High temperature mechanical strength;

      ● Good thermal expansion: the expansion rate can reach 16% -18%;

      ● Good thermal shock stability.

    Particle Size

      80 - 120 mesh 325 mesh(Can be processed according to customer’s special requirements)

    Application Fields

      Ceramic materials, refractory materials(expanding agent), casting materials, silicon aluminum alloys, sagger kiln furniture, precision casting, insulation and decorative materials, etc.
